IIST is very good college. Its curriculum is oriented towards space . Placements are very good . You get direct entry in ISRO from this college . Many PSU also come here for recruitment.
If you have interest in ISRO you can definitely go for this college.

KCET is an entrance exam for colleges in Karnataka, including B.Tech in Aeronautical Engineering in Bangalore. Like JEE, this exam consists of multiple-choice questions and the subjects covered include Physics, Chemistry, Mathematics, and Biology, depending on the course applied for. Candidates should have completed their 10+2 or equivalent examination with relevant subjects to appear in the exam. B.Tech in Aeronautical Engineering. For undergraduate admission, you need a minimum of 50-55% aggregate marks in PCM (Physics, Chemistry, Mathematics) in Class 12. The admission is based on JEE Main and JEE Advanced scores.

The 2025 cutoff for BTech in Aeronautical Engineering at ACS College of Engineering is going to be announced soon. However, as per the comparison of the cutoffs for the academic years 2024 and 2023 on the basis of COMEDK UGET rank, it can be evaluated that the cutoff for BE in Aeronautical Engineering has decreased from the year 2023 to 2024, which means the competition has increased. To get the exact idea, check out the cutoff details of the academic year of both years in the table below:
Course | 2023 | 2024 |
---|---|---|
BE in Aeronautical Engineering | 72833 | 62967 |
